An Post has said the issue of staff off work due to Covid is placing a strain on their delivery services.
It says there has been a “significant increase” in the number of staff not at work.
In some situations post offices have had to temporarily close.
A spokesperson said “This is placing a temporary strain on our resources which may impact on our regular service delivery levels across our Mails & Parcels delivery network, and at some Post Offices.
“We have a range of contingency plans in place, and our staff and Postmasters are working hard to minimise the impact on customers.
“We apologise for any inconvenience this situation may cause. The Health & Safety of our Staff and Customers is our priority.
“Where any post office has to temporarily close, Social Welfare benefit payments will be transferred to a neighbouring office.”
